Output e24c85edeb4cebce5cb2f97323429325fb8233acda9e018291c8440e7dbb6c7e:156

value
28799
script pubkey
OP_0 OP_PUSHBYTES_20 ef80d30b70eac0b5b9fc5fdcee604dcaa44cfeac
address
bc1qa7qdxzmsatqttw0utlwwuczde2jyel4vz9aahj
transaction
e24c85edeb4cebce5cb2f97323429325fb8233acda9e018291c8440e7dbb6c7e
spent
true